Reith Lectures 2007

So the Reith lectures are run each year by the BBC. They get in an international speaker to talk on a subject of interest and importance. This year it was given by Jeff Sachs and is on climate change. There’s a link to a blog which has all the audio available for download as mp3.

Apparently it’s a fairly optimistic take on the whole thing which could be good for a change.
